Mobile window repair can be done either expertly or DIY, depending on the level of the damage and the user's comfort level. Here is a detailed guide to the repair process:

Assess the Damage
Figure out the level of the damage. Is it a minor crack or a complete shatter?Inspect if the screen is still practical and responsive.
Gather Tools and Materials
Tools: Screwdriver, spying tool, suction cup, heat weapon, and a new screen.Products: Adhesive, cleaning wipes, and a screen protector.
Dismantle the Phone
Shut off the phone and get rid of the battery (if possible).Utilize the screwdriver to get rid of screws and the suction cup to gently lift the screen.Thoroughly detach the screen from the motherboard using the spying tool.
Eliminate the Damaged Screen
Utilize the heat weapon to soften the adhesive holding the screen in place.Carefully pry off the old screen, being careful not to damage the frame.
Install the New Screen
Clean the frame and the area where the new screen will be placed.Use new adhesive and carefully position the new screen.Reconnect the screen to the motherboard and secure it in place.
Reassemble the Phone
Reattach the battery and any other parts.Screw the phone back together and check the new screen.
Evaluate the Phone
Switch on the phone and look for any issues with the screen, touch level of sensitivity, and other functions.Install a screen protector to avoid future damage.Professional Repair Services
